Background
Patterson, Robert Youngman was born on February 1, 1921 in West Palm Beach, Florida, United States. Son of Robert Youngman and Christine Helene (Johnson) Patterson.

Bachelor of Arts, University Florida, 1942; Bachelor of Laws, Juris Doctor, U. Florida, 1950.
Sole practice, Jacksonville, 1950-1952;
from assistant counsel to assistant general counsel, Florida Public Service Commission, Tallahassee, 1952-1958;
general attorney, assistant secretary-treasurer, Florida Gas Company (and subsidiary), Winter Park, 1959-1962;
vice president, general attorney, Florida Gas Company (and subsidiary), Winter Park, 1959-1979;
director state and community affairs, Continental Resources Company, 1979-1988;
director state and community affairs, Florida Gas. Transmission Company, Maitland, 1979-1988;
consultant, 1988-1991;
retired, 1991. Member Florida Nuclear Development Commission, 1957-1960.
Chairman Association Industries Florida, 1976.
Served to captain Army of the United States, World World War II, European Theatre of Operations. Member American Bar Association, Federal Power Bar Association (past chairman rate committee), Federal Energy Bar Association, Florida Bar Association (past chairman administrative law committee, chairman administrative law section 1978, chairman energy committee 1981), Orange County Bar Association, Interstate Commerce Commission Practitioners Association, American Judicature Society, Interstate, Southern natural gas associations, Florida Natural Gas Association (W.J. Smith Distinguished Svc. award 1989), Florida Chamber of Commerce, Tallahassee Chamber of Commerce, Orlando Chamber of Commerce (past chairman state legislation committee), Winter Park Chamber of Commerce (director, past chairman congressional action committee), U. Florida Alumni Association, Kappa Sigma, Delta Theta Phi.
Married Lorraine Hillyer, June 14, 1952. Children: Robert Youngman III, Patricia Hillyer.
